Kanazawa, located in Ishikawa Prefecture on the west coast of Japan, is renowned for its Edo-period architecture, historic wooden teahouses, and geisha districts–particularly Higashi Chaya and Kazue Machi, both of which you’ll visit during this tour. Higashi Chaya is the most renowned geisha district in Kanazawa. This historic area is characterized by its Edo-period architecture, featuring traditional wooden teahouses where geisha entertain guests with performances, music, and dance. Lesser known but equally captivating, Kazue Machi is another geisha district in Kanazawa. Unlike the larger Higashi Chaya, Kazue Machi offers a more intimate experience, with fewer teahouses that maintain a sense of exclusivity.
